The three films of the Star Wars saga?Star Wars, The Empire Strikes Back, and the Return of the Jedi?rank among the most popular of the modern era, with ticket and merchandise sales in excess of three billion dollars. Today, collecting Star Wars memorabilia has become one of the hottest hobbies around. The first illustrated Star Wars book to feature the multitude of merchandising spin-offs generated by the film?and the only one that traces the transformation of the movie's fabulous characters, creatures, and vehicles from original concepts and prototypes into toys, clothing, and dozens of other objects?this spectacular volume is a veritable Star Wars fan's bible. A complete overview of a modern marketing extravaganza, featuring more than 150 full-color images of collectible items, the book takes readers behind the scenes and includes many never-before-published sketches and photographs from the Lucasfilm and Kenner toy archives. A lively text featuring recent interviews with George Lucas, among others connected with the film, completes this intriguing and fascinating glimpse into one of popular culture's most engaging phenomena. Hardcover, 10-in. x 9 1/2-in., 132 pages, full color. Cover price $29.95.

Wolf Pack, script by James Van Hise, pencils by Kevin Tuma, inks by Barb Kaalberg; 2023: Paul Reid wants to know how Britt I dealt with having to kill a man early in his Green Hornet career (as detailed in the previous issue), but the man's journals hold no discussion of the aftermath. However, Ikano Kato's do. 1936: Britt's college roommate, Charles Binford, has written to the Daily Sentinel, asking for an investigation into strange happenings near his home in the Canadian hinterlands. Britt takes advantage of the opportunity to get away from the pressures of the paper, the city, and his double life, with Kato deciding to go along to keep an eye on his troubled friend. However, on the first morning, Nazi soldiers break into the cabin and capture the three men, marching them to a nearby location where they are to be slave labor, building a secret airstrip. Written by James Robinson. Art by Jackson Guice and John Beatty. Cover by John Higgins. The half-Terminator Dudley and Colonel Mary Randall are reunited finally, as they resume their quest to save Sarah Connor and ensure the birth of her son, John. But Dudley is having problems controlling his Terminator half -- and Mary finds out the hard way! The penultimate chapter in Dark Horse's final Terminator series moves inexorably toward a climactic encounter with the new Terminator on the block. James Robinson teams with pencil artist Jackson Guice (Nick Fury: Agent of SHIELD) and inker John Beatty. British artist John Higgins (The Thing from Another World) supplies the cover painting. 32 pages, FC. Cover price $2.50.
